U.S. BANK NATIONAL ASSOCIATION v. JALAS

531745.

195 A.D.3d 1122 (2021)

149 N.Y.S.3d 638

2021 NY Slip Op 03506

U.S. Bank National Association, as Trustee, Appellant, v. Chaim Jalas, Respondents, et al., Defendants.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, Third Department.

Decided June 3, 2021.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

J.J. Robbin Law PLLC, Armonk ( Jacquelyn A. DiCicco of counsel), for appellant.

Silber Law Firm, LLC, New York City ( Meyer Y. Silber of counsel), for Chaim Jalas, respondent.

Egan Jr., J.P., Clark, Aarons and Reynolds Fitzgerald, JJ., concur.


In September 2007, defendant Chaim Jalas (hereinafter defendant) executed a note to borrow $136,000 from Bank of America, N.A., secured by a mortgage against real property located in the Town of Fallsburg, Sullivan County.
